Adam Lambert Early Life

On January 29, 1982, in Indianapolis, Indiana, Adam Mitchel Lambert was born. Leila, Adam’s mother, was a dental hygienist, while Eber, Adam’s father, worked as a program manager for Novatel Wireless when Adam was little. However, Leila has since shifted gears and is now an interior designer. After relocating to California, Lambert’s parents welcomed his younger brother, Neil.

Adam’s upbringing was religiously Jewish, with his mother being Jewish and his attendance at Hebrew school. Starting when she was just 9 years old, Lambert had appearances in professional productions of shows including “You’re a Good Man, Charlie Brown,” “Peter Pan,” “Hello, Dolly!” and “Grease.” Adam participated in the jazz band, the chorus, and the school productions while he was a student at Mount Carmel High School.

He then relocated to Orange County to enroll at California State University, Fullerton, but after just five weeks he decided to abandon his studies and focus on a career in Hollywood instead. adam lambert net worth.

Adam Lambert Career

At the age of 19, Lambert got his start in the professional world with a 10-month gig on a cruise ship, and just two years later, he landed a role in a European tour of “Hair.” Adam played the part of Joshua in the Kodak Theatre’s 2004 production of “The Ten Commandments: The Musical,” starring Val Kilmer; the following year, he was cast as a member of the ensemble and understudy for the character of Fiyero in a touring production of “Wicked” .

(he reprised these roles in a 2007 Los Angeles production). Lambert appeared on the eighth season of “American Idol” in 2009 and received unanimous praise from the show’s judges. Despite the fact that Adam finished in second place on “American Idol” to Kris Allen, he has remained one of the show’s most popular candidates and was named fifth on MTV’s list of “The 10 Greatest ‘American Idol’ Contestants of All Time” in 2009. adam lambert net worth.

Adam Lambert Personal Life

Adam is out as gay and has been in relationships with Sauli Koskinenm, a Finnish TV personality, from November 2010 to April 2013, and with Javi Costa Polo, a model, from March 2019 to November 2019. Lambert has made a name for himself in the nonprofit sector through his work with groups like DonorsChoose, MusiCares, charity: water, and The Trevor Project.

The We Are Family Foundation recognized his efforts to spread positive messages through his music by awarding him their 2013 Unity Award. Adam started his own organization in 2019 to advocate for LGBTQ+ people’s rights: the Feel Something Foundation.

Aside from the Make-A-Wish Foundation Ball in 2013, he also performed at a benefit for Marylanders for Marriage Equality in 2012 and a concert with Queen and Elton John for the Olena Pinchuk ANTI AIDS Foundation in 2012. For the families of the victims of the 2016 horrific massacre at Orlando’s Pulse nightclub, Lambert also contributed vocals to the charity track “Hands.” adam lambert net worth.

Awards and Honors

Lambert won the Teen Choice Award for Male Reality/Variety Star as well as the Young Hollywood Award for Artist of the Year in 2009. With “Whataya Want from Me,” he took home the UR Fav International Video trophy at that year’s MuchMusic Video Awards in Canada. At the 24th annual GLAAD Media Awards in 2013, he was honored as both an Outstanding Music Artist and the recipient of the Davidson/Valentini Award. The year after Adam was selected as one of “People” magazine’s Most Beautiful People, he was included in Barbara Walters’ “10 Most Fascinating People” program.

Real Estate

Lambert dropped $3,000,000 on a 3,800-square-foot mansion in the Hollywood Hills in 2014. He originally advertised it for $4 million in 2017, lowered the price to $3.35 million in May 2019, took it off the market in January 2020, and relisted it for the same price the following month with a different realtor.
